When selling during the summer months especially, but truly anytime during the year in warm climates, show off your outdoor areas. Outdoor areas extend the living space of the home whether as an entertaining area or a quiet place to have coffee in the morning. Create seating areas on the deck or a patio. For open houses and showings, set outdoor tables, to show how they can be used for extra entertaining spaces. By staging outdoor spaces, potential buyers will know how you use them, making it easier for potential buyers to picture themselves in this space.
The Irvine Barley Theatre is hosting the 9th Annual Gala of the Stars, Festival Ballet Theatre. This performance is part of the Orange County International Ballet Festival. Many international ballet artists will be performing at this event. Guest artists include Tiler Peck of the New York City Ballet, Maria Kochetkova of the American Ballet Theatre, Xander Parish of the Mariinsky Theatre, Yuan Yuan Tan of San Francisco Ballet and Jamie Kopit of the American Ballet Theatre. The performance will take place on Friday, August 12th. The performance begins at 6pm and runs until 8pm. The Irvine Barclay Theatre is located at 4242 Campus Drive in Irvine. Tickets range in price from $65 to $200. VIP tickets are available and include dinner with the ballet artists. This performance is put on in conjugation with Youth America Grand Prix. Shady Canyon is a group of the three luxury home developments with approximately 400 residences. The community is surrounded by 16,000 acres of natural green space. Located at 28 Sage Creek, this 7,200 square foot home is part of the Shady Canyon Custom development. This five bedroom, six bathroom home was built in 2006. This Santa Barbara style estate was designed by Anthony Thibert and built by Pridemark Construction. Attention to detail can be seen in the vintage reclaimed wood beams, limestone fireplaces and handmade light fixtures. The home features a gourmet kitchen, formal living room and dining room and detached casita. The casita has a kitchenette, bath, sitting room and bedroom, perfect for guests. This home sits on a very large 33,000 square foot piece of property. Outdoors, homeowners’ will enjoy a loggia, an outdoor fireplace, barbeque area and putting green. This residence is near the clubhouse. In addition to the clubhouse, amenities include a swimming pool, tennis courts and a fitness center. Students living in this area attend Bonita Canyon Elementary School, Rancho San Joaquin Middle School and University High School.
